Home
last modified time | relevance | path

Searched refs:blk_status_t (Results 1 – 25 of 133) sorted by relevance

123456

/linux/include/linux/
H A Dblk_types.h96 typedef u8 __bitwise blk_status_t; typedef
99 #define BLK_STS_NOTSUPP ((__force blk_status_t)1)
100 #define BLK_STS_TIMEOUT ((__force blk_status_t)2)
101 #define BLK_STS_NOSPC ((__force blk_status_t)3)
102 #define BLK_STS_TRANSPORT ((__force blk_status_t)4)
103 #define BLK_STS_TARGET ((__force blk_status_t)5)
104 #define BLK_STS_RESV_CONFLICT ((__force blk_status_t)6)
105 #define BLK_STS_MEDIUM ((__force blk_status_t)7)
106 #define BLK_STS_PROTECTION ((__force blk_status_t)8)
107 #define BLK_STS_RESOURCE ((__force blk_status_t)9)
[all …]
H A Dblk-mq.h24 typedef enum rq_end_io_ret (rq_end_io_fn)(struct request *, blk_status_t);
565 blk_status_t (*queue_rq)(struct blk_mq_hw_ctx *,
853 void blk_mq_end_request(struct request *rq, blk_status_t error);
854 void __blk_mq_end_request(struct request *rq, blk_status_t error);
1011 blk_status_t blk_insert_cloned_request(struct request *rq);
1033 blk_status_t blk_execute_rq(struct request *rq, bool at_head);
1142 bool blk_update_request(struct request *rq, blk_status_t error,
/linux/drivers/block/null_blk/
H A Dzoned.c287 static blk_status_t null_check_active(struct nullb_device *dev) in null_check_active()
299 static blk_status_t null_check_open(struct nullb_device *dev) in null_check_open()
330 static blk_status_t null_check_zone_resources(struct nullb_device *dev, in null_check_zone_resources()
333 blk_status_t ret; in null_check_zone_resources()
350 static blk_status_t null_zone_write(struct nullb_cmd *cmd, sector_t sector, in null_zone_write()
356 blk_status_t ret; in null_zone_write()
440 static blk_status_t null_open_zone(struct nullb_device *dev, in null_open_zone()
443 blk_status_t ret = BLK_STS_OK; in null_open_zone()
497 static blk_status_t null_close_zone(struct nullb_device *dev, in null_close_zone()
544 static blk_status_t null_finish_zone(struct nullb_device *dev, in null_finish_zone()
[all …]
H A Dnull_blk.h19 blk_status_t error;
129 blk_status_t null_handle_discard(struct nullb_device *dev, sector_t sector,
131 blk_status_t null_process_cmd(struct nullb_cmd *cmd, enum req_op op,
140 blk_status_t null_process_zoned_cmd(struct nullb_cmd *cmd, enum req_op op,
158 static inline blk_status_t null_process_zoned_cmd(struct nullb_cmd *cmd, in null_process_zoned_cmd()
H A Dmain.c1172 blk_status_t null_handle_discard(struct nullb_device *dev, in null_handle_discard()
1193 static blk_status_t null_handle_flush(struct nullb *nullb) in null_handle_flush()
1244 static blk_status_t null_handle_rq(struct nullb_cmd *cmd) in null_handle_rq()
1269 static inline blk_status_t null_handle_throttled(struct nullb_cmd *cmd) in null_handle_throttled()
1273 blk_status_t sts = BLK_STS_OK; in null_handle_throttled()
1290 static inline blk_status_t null_handle_badblocks(struct nullb_cmd *cmd, in null_handle_badblocks()
1304 static inline blk_status_t null_handle_memory_backed(struct nullb_cmd *cmd, in null_handle_memory_backed()
1357 blk_status_t null_process_cmd(struct nullb_cmd *cmd, enum req_op op, in null_process_cmd()
1361 blk_status_t ret; in null_process_cmd()
1380 blk_status_t sts; in null_handle_cmd()
[all …]
/linux/drivers/md/
H A Ddm-rq.c23 blk_status_t error;
84 blk_status_t error = clone->bi_status; in end_clone_bio()
157 static void dm_end_request(struct request *clone, blk_status_t error) in dm_end_request()
204 static void dm_done(struct request *clone, blk_status_t error, bool mapped) in dm_done()
276 static void dm_complete_request(struct request *rq, blk_status_t error) in dm_complete_request()
291 static void dm_kill_unmapped_request(struct request *rq, blk_status_t error) in dm_kill_unmapped_request()
298 blk_status_t error) in end_clone_request()
369 blk_status_t ret; in map_request()
477 static blk_status_t dm_mq_queue_rq(struct blk_mq_hw_ctx *hctx, in dm_mq_queue_rq()
/linux/fs/btrfs/
H A Dfile-item.h54 blk_status_t btrfs_lookup_bio_sums(struct btrfs_bio *bbio);
65 blk_status_t btrfs_csum_one_bio(struct btrfs_bio *bbio);
66 blk_status_t btrfs_alloc_dummy_sum(struct btrfs_bio *bbio);
H A Dbio.c137 void btrfs_bio_end_io(struct btrfs_bio *bbio, blk_status_t status) in btrfs_bio_end_io()
281 blk_status_t status = bbio->bio.bi_status; in btrfs_check_read_bio()
523 static blk_status_t btrfs_bio_csum(struct btrfs_bio *bbio) in btrfs_bio_csum()
554 blk_status_t ret; in run_one_async_start()
679 blk_status_t ret; in btrfs_submit_chunk()
/linux/block/
H A Dblk-crypto-internal.h73 blk_status_t blk_crypto_get_keyslot(struct blk_crypto_profile *profile,
166 blk_status_t __blk_crypto_rq_get_keyslot(struct request *rq);
167 static inline blk_status_t blk_crypto_rq_get_keyslot(struct request *rq) in blk_crypto_rq_get_keyslot()
H A Dblk-flush.c150 unsigned int seq, blk_status_t error) in blk_flush_complete_seq()
202 blk_status_t error) in flush_end_io()
338 blk_status_t error) in mq_flush_data_end_io()
/linux/drivers/md/bcache/
H A Dio.c83 blk_status_t error, in bch_count_io_errors()
138 blk_status_t error, const char *m) in bch_bbio_count_io_errors()
168 blk_status_t error, const char *m) in bch_bbio_endio()
H A Drequest.h14 blk_status_t status;
/linux/drivers/s390/block/
H A Dscm_blk.h35 blk_status_t error;
43 void scm_blk_irq(struct scm_device *, void *, blk_status_t);
H A Dscm_blk.c253 blk_status_t *error; in scm_request_finish()
283 static blk_status_t scm_blk_request(struct blk_mq_hw_ctx *hctx, in scm_blk_request()
402 void scm_blk_irq(struct scm_device *scmdev, void *data, blk_status_t error) in scm_blk_irq()
420 blk_status_t *error = blk_mq_rq_to_pdu(req); in scm_blk_request_done()
461 bdev->tag_set.cmd_size = sizeof(blk_status_t); in scm_blk_dev_setup()
/linux/drivers/block/
H A Dps3disk.c95 static blk_status_t ps3disk_submit_request_sg(struct ps3_storage_device *dev, in ps3disk_submit_request_sg()
142 static blk_status_t ps3disk_submit_flush_request(struct ps3_storage_device *dev, in ps3disk_submit_flush_request()
163 static blk_status_t ps3disk_do_request(struct ps3_storage_device *dev, in ps3disk_do_request()
180 static blk_status_t ps3disk_queue_rq(struct blk_mq_hw_ctx *hctx, in ps3disk_queue_rq()
186 blk_status_t ret; in ps3disk_queue_rq()
203 blk_status_t error; in ps3disk_interrupt()
H A Dvirtio_blk.c114 static inline blk_status_t virtblk_result(u8 status) in virtblk_result()
239 static blk_status_t virtblk_setup_cmd(struct virtio_device *vdev, in virtblk_setup_cmd()
338 blk_status_t status = virtblk_result(virtblk_vbr_status(vbr)); in virtblk_request_done()
392 static blk_status_t virtblk_fail_to_queue(struct request *req, int rc) in virtblk_fail_to_queue()
405 static blk_status_t virtblk_prep_rq(struct blk_mq_hw_ctx *hctx, in virtblk_prep_rq()
410 blk_status_t status; in virtblk_prep_rq()
427 static blk_status_t virtio_queue_rq(struct blk_mq_hw_ctx *hctx, in virtio_queue_rq()
436 blk_status_t status; in virtio_queue_rq()
/linux/arch/s390/include/asm/
H A Deadm.h112 blk_status_t error);
119 void scm_irq_handler(struct aob *aob, blk_status_t error);
/linux/drivers/nvdimm/
H A Dpmem.c111 static blk_status_t pmem_clear_poison(struct pmem_device *pmem, in pmem_clear_poison()
143 static blk_status_t read_pmem(struct page *page, unsigned int off, in read_pmem()
165 static blk_status_t pmem_do_read(struct pmem_device *pmem, in pmem_do_read()
169 blk_status_t rc; in pmem_do_read()
181 static blk_status_t pmem_do_write(struct pmem_device *pmem, in pmem_do_write()
189 blk_status_t rc = pmem_clear_poison(pmem, pmem_off, len); in pmem_do_write()
204 blk_status_t rc = 0; in pmem_submit_bio()
/linux/drivers/scsi/
H A Dscsi_lib.c624 static bool scsi_end_request(struct request *req, blk_status_t error, in scsi_end_request()
673 * scsi_result_to_blk_status - translate a SCSI result code into blk_status_t
676 * Translate a SCSI result code into a blk_status_t value.
678 static blk_status_t scsi_result_to_blk_status(int result) in scsi_result_to_blk_status()
787 blk_status_t blk_stat; in scsi_io_completion_action()
957 blk_status_t *blk_statp) in scsi_io_completion_nz_result()
1049 blk_status_t blk_stat = BLK_STS_OK; in scsi_io_completion()
1109 blk_status_t scsi_alloc_sgtables(struct scsi_cmnd *cmd) in scsi_alloc_sgtables()
1115 blk_status_t ret; in scsi_alloc_sgtables()
1262 static blk_status_t scsi_setup_scsi_cmn
[all...]
H A Dsd.h238 blk_status_t sd_zbc_setup_zone_mgmt_cmnd(struct scsi_cmnd *cmd,
258 static inline blk_status_t sd_zbc_setup_zone_mgmt_cmnd(struct scsi_cmnd *cmd, in sd_zbc_setup_zone_mgmt_cmnd()
H A Dsd_zbc.c297 static blk_status_t sd_zbc_cmnd_checks(struct scsi_cmnd *cmd) in sd_zbc_cmnd_checks()
327 blk_status_t sd_zbc_setup_zone_mgmt_cmnd(struct scsi_cmnd *cmd, in sd_zbc_setup_zone_mgmt_cmnd()
334 blk_status_t ret; in sd_zbc_setup_zone_mgmt_cmnd()
/linux/fs/jfs/
H A Djfs_metapage.c79 blk_status_t status;
142 static inline void dec_io(struct folio *folio, blk_status_t status, in dec_io() argument
143 void (*handler)(struct folio *, blk_status_t)) in dec_io()
266 static void last_read_complete(struct folio *folio, blk_status_t status) in last_read_complete()
305 static void last_write_complete(struct folio *folio, blk_status_t status) in last_write_complete()
/linux/include/scsi/
H A Dscsi_driver.h17 blk_status_t (*init_command)(struct scsi_cmnd *);
H A Dscsi_dh.h60 blk_status_t (*prep_fn)(struct scsi_device *, struct request *);
/linux/drivers/nvme/host/
H A Dnvme.h784 blk_status_t nvme_host_path_error(struct request *req);
832 blk_status_t nvme_setup_cmd(struct nvme_ns *ns, struct request *req);
833 blk_status_t nvme_fail_nonready_command(struct nvme_ctrl *ctrl,
1081 blk_status_t nvme_setup_zone_mgmt_send(struct nvme_ns *ns, struct request *req,
1085 static inline blk_status_t nvme_setup_zone_mgmt_send(struct nvme_ns *ns, in nvme_setup_zone_mgmt_send()

123456